Importing Excel Table into MHB Forum

  • Context: MHB 
  • Thread starter Thread starter GerryZ
  • Start date Start date
  • Tags Tags
    Excel Forum Table
Click For Summary
SUMMARY

This discussion focuses on importing Excel tables into the MHB forum using copy and paste functionality. Users confirmed that the process works seamlessly when the WYSIWYG mode is enabled in vBulletin. To enhance the appearance of tables, it is necessary to add the attribute class: grid to the opening TABLE tag when in non-WYSIWYG mode. Additionally, users expressed the need for a feature that automatically applies this grid class to ensure all pasted tables maintain a consistent format.

PREREQUISITES
  • Familiarity with vBulletin 4.2.2 forum software
  • Understanding of WYSIWYG editors and their functionalities
  • Basic knowledge of BBCode for formatting tables
  • Experience with JavaScript for potential customization of forum features
NEXT STEPS
  • Research how to implement custom BBCode in vBulletin for table formatting
  • Learn about JavaScript integration in vBulletin for enhancing user experience
  • Explore vBulletin plugins that facilitate Excel table imports
  • Investigate user interface design for adding buttons to automate formatting tasks
USEFUL FOR

This discussion is beneficial for forum administrators, web developers, and users interested in enhancing the functionality of vBulletin forums, particularly those focused on Excel-related content.

GerryZ
Messages
10
Reaction score
0
Hello MHB Gurus
I'm writing this section but I'm not sure if is the right one
I wonder if is possible to import an Excel Table (with copy and paste) from excel into the forum with line and boarders
Thank you for your help

7 mag 2014 10:20 1,3928
7 mag 2014 10:25 1,3926
7 mag 2014 10:30 1,3925
7 mag 2014 10:35 1,3924
7 mag 2014 10:40 1,3923
7 mag 2014 10:45 1,3917
7 mag 2014 10:50 1,3917
7 mag 2014 10:55 1,3919
7 mag 2014 11:00 1,3913
7 mag 2014 11:05 1,3914
7 mag 2014 11:10 1,3912
7 mag 2014 11:15 1,3912
7 mag 2014 11:20 1,3914
7 mag 2014 11:25 1,3913
7 mag 2014 11:30 1,3915
7 mag 2014 11:35 1,3917
7 mag 2014 11:40 1,3918
 
Last edited:
Physics news on Phys.org
GerryZ said:
Hello MHB Gurus
I'm writing this section but I'm not sure if is the right one
I wonder if is possible to import an Excel Table (with copy and paste) from excel into the forum with line and boarders
Thank you for your help

7 mag 2014 10:20 1,3928
7 mag 2014 10:25 1,3926
7 mag 2014 10:30 1,3925
7 mag 2014 10:35 1,3924
7 mag 2014 10:40 1,3923
7 mag 2014 10:45 1,3917
7 mag 2014 10:50 1,3917
7 mag 2014 10:55 1,3919
7 mag 2014 11:00 1,3913
7 mag 2014 11:05 1,3914
7 mag 2014 11:10 1,3912
7 mag 2014 11:15 1,3912
7 mag 2014 11:20 1,3914
7 mag 2014 11:25 1,3913
7 mag 2014 11:30 1,3915
7 mag 2014 11:35 1,3917
7 mag 2014 11:40 1,3918

Hi GerryZ! Welcome to MBH! ;)

It works out of the box for me.
I've converted your table back to Excel, and then copied and pasted it here.
We do need to have WYSIWYG mode on (top left speed button).
To improve the appearance I've added [M]="class: grid"[/M] (in non-WYSIWYG mode) to get a full grid around the cells.

[TABLE="class: grid"]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:20:00 AM[/TD]
[TD="align: left"] 1,3928[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:25:00 AM[/TD]
[TD="align: left"] 1,3926[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:30:00 AM[/TD]
[TD="align: left"] 1,3925[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:35:00 AM[/TD]
[TD="align: left"] 1,3924[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:40:00 AM[/TD]
[TD="align: left"] 1,3923[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:45:00 AM[/TD]
[TD="align: left"] 1,3917[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:50:00 AM[/TD]
[TD="align: left"] 1,3917[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]10:55:00 AM[/TD]
[TD="align: left"] 1,3919[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:00:00 AM[/TD]
[TD="align: left"] 1,3913[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:05:00 AM[/TD]
[TD="align: left"] 1,3914[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:10:00 AM[/TD]
[TD="align: left"] 1,3912[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:15:00 AM[/TD]
[TD="align: left"] 1,3912[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:20:00 AM[/TD]
[TD="align: left"] 1,3914[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:25:00 AM[/TD]
[TD="align: left"] 1,3913[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:30:00 AM[/TD]
[TD="align: left"] 1,3915[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:35:00 AM[/TD]
[TD="align: left"] 1,3917[/TD]
[/TR]
[TR]
[TD="align: left"]7 mag 2014[/TD]
[TD="align: right"]11:40:00 AM[/TD]
[TD="align: left"] 1,3918[/TD]
[/TR]
[/TABLE]
 
It works out of the box for me.
I've converted your table back to Excel, and then copied and pasted it here.
We do need to have WYSIWYG mode on (top left speed button).
To improve the appearance I've added [M]="class: grid"[/M] (in non-WYSIWYG mode) to get a full grid around the cells.

Wooowww Beautiful!
So I want to tell my story, I'm Italian (sorry if i dn't speak good iEnglish) and I' am a founder and owner of ForumExcel.it (vB 4.2.2) italian forum that treat excel , so for me is very important that all of my users (expecially newbie) tha are able tu post a nice table like you did, so I wnat to do a setting directly in AdminCp for all forum
Is this possible..
Thank you
 
Last edited:
GerryZ said:
Wooowww Beautiful!
So I want to tell my story, I'm Italian (sorry if i dn't speak good iEnglish) and I' am a founder and owner of ForumExcel.it (vB 4.2.2) italian forum that treat excel , so for me is very important that all of my users (expecially newbie) tha are able tu post a nice table like you did, so I wnat to do a setting directly in AdminCp for all forum
Is this possible..
Thank you
NOME INCASSO TOTALE
Anna 39
Anna 48
Anna 22
Anna 37 146
Giorgia 50
Giorgia 46
Giorgia 50
Giorgia 40
Giorgia 38 224
Giulia 42
Giulia 39
Giulia 32 113
Luisa 41
Luisa 25
Luisa 40 106

hummm! not working:mad:
 
GerryZ said:
NOME INCASSO TOTALE
Anna 39
Anna 48
Anna 22
Anna 37 146
Giorgia 50
Giorgia 46
Giorgia 50
Giorgia 40
Giorgia 38 224
Giulia 42
Giulia 39
Giulia 32 113
Luisa 41
Luisa 25
Luisa 40 106

hummm! not working:mad:

You need to wrap your data in the table-associated BBCodes...for example the following code:

Code:
[table="width: 500, class: grid"]
[tr]
	[td]NOME[/td]
	[td]INCASSO[/td]
	[td]TOTALE[/td]
[/tr]
[tr]
	[td]Anna[/td]
	[td]39[/td]
	[td][/td]
[/tr]
[tr]
	[td]Anna[/td]
	[td]48[/td]
	[td][/td]
[/tr]
[tr]
	[td]Anna[/td]
	[td]22[/td]
	[td][/td]
[/tr]
[tr]
	[td]Anna[/td]
	[td]37[/td]
	[td]146[/td]
[/tr]
[/table]

produces:

[table="width: 500, class: grid"]
[tr]
[td]NOME[/td]
[td]INCASSO[/td]
[td]TOTALE[/td]
[/tr]
[tr]
[td]Anna[/td]
[td]39[/td]
[td][/td]
[/tr]
[tr]
[td]Anna[/td]
[td]48[/td]
[td][/td]
[/tr]
[tr]
[td]Anna[/td]
[td]22[/td]
[td][/td]
[/tr]
[tr]
[td]Anna[/td]
[td]37[/td]
[td]146[/td]
[/tr]
[/table]

However, as I like Serena stated (which I didn't know), if you copy/paste directly from Excel into a vBulletin post where the WYSIWYG editor is being used, the table codes will be created for you. :D
 
MarkFL said:
You need to wrap your data in the table-associated BBCodes...for example the following code:

Code:
[table="width: 500, class: grid"]
[tr]
    [td]NOME[/td]
    [td]INCASSO[/td]
    [td]TOTALE[/td]
[/tr]
[tr]
    [td]Anna[/td]
    [td]39[/td]
    [td][/td]
[/tr]
[tr]
    [td]Anna[/td]
    [td]48[/td]
    [td][/td]
[/tr]
[tr]
    [td]Anna[/td]
    [td]22[/td]
    [td][/td]
[/tr]
[tr]
    [td]Anna[/td]
    [td]37[/td]
    [td]146[/td]
[/tr]
[/table]

produces:

[TABLE="class: grid, width: 500"]
[TR]
[TD]NOME[/TD]
[TD]INCASSO[/TD]
[TD]TOTALE[/TD]
[/TR]
[TR]
[TD]Anna[/TD]
[TD]39[/TD]
[TD][/TD]
[/TR]
[TR]
[TD]Anna[/TD]
[TD]48[/TD]
[TD][/TD]
[/TR]
[TR]
[TD]Anna[/TD]
[TD]22[/TD]
[TD][/TD]
[/TR]
[TR]
[TD]Anna[/TD]
[TD]37[/TD]
[TD]146[/TD]
[/TR]
[/TABLE]

However, as I like Serena stated (which I didn't know), if you copy/paste directly from Excel into a vBulletin post where the WYSIWYG editor is being used, the table codes will be created for you. :D

Hello MarkFl I think i know you!:D

This the new setting in AdminCp as you said

qAdiVcB.png


and this the resul well allined but no borders

7H6Pz2Y.png
Also in your forum i not able to paste boders
[TABLE="width: 293"]
[TR]
[TD]NORD[/TD]
[TD="align: right"]15-gen-05[/TD]
[TD]Frank[/TD]
[/TR]
[TR]
[TD]NORD[/TD]
[TD="align: right"]17-gen-01[/TD]
[TD]Anna[/TD]
[/TR]
[TR]
[TD]NORD[/TD]
[TD="align: right"]16-gen-08[/TD]
[TD]Joe[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]15-gen-11[/TD]
[TD]Luis[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]22-gen-09[/TD]
[TD]Anna[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]18-gen-17[/TD]
[TD]Pietro[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]18-gen-14[/TD]
[TD]Luis[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]21-gen-13[/TD]
[TD]Giorgia[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]7-giu-14[/TD]
[TD]Giulia[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]14-lug-12[/TD]
[TD]Anna[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]12-apr-19[/TD]
[TD]Giulia[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]13-feb-22[/TD]
[TD]Luis[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]11-mar-20[/TD]
[TD]Andrea[/TD]
[/TR]
[/TABLE]
 
Yes, we are conversing both here and at vBorg about separate issues. :D

In order to get borders, you will have to turn off WYSIWG mode, and edit the BB Code to add [M]="class: grid"[/M] inside the opening TABLE tag. In other words, change:

[m]
[/m]

to:

[m][TABLE="class: grid"][/m]
 
MarkFL said:
Yes, we are conversing both here and at vBorg about separate issues. :D

In order to get borders, you will have to turn off WYSIWG mode, and edit the BB Code to add [M]="class: grid"[/M] inside the opening TABLE tag. In other words, change:

[m]
[/m]

to:

[m][TABLE="class: grid"][/m]


Not workin
is possible to add a botton to add the grid?
 
I think I did it
Have a look

[TABLE="class: grid"]
[TR]
[TD]criterio[/TD]
[TD]date[/TD]
[TD]Nome[/TD]
[/TR]
[TR]
[TD]NORD[/TD]
[TD="align: right"]15-gen-05[/TD]
[TD]Frank[/TD]
[/TR]
[TR]
[TD]NORD[/TD]
[TD="align: right"]17-gen-01[/TD]
[TD]Anna[/TD]
[/TR]
[TR]
[TD]NORD[/TD]
[TD="align: right"]16-gen-08[/TD]
[TD]Joe[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]15-gen-11[/TD]
[TD]Luis[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]22-gen-09[/TD]
[TD]Anna[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]18-gen-17[/TD]
[TD]Pietro[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]18-gen-14[/TD]
[TD]Luis[/TD]
[/TR]
[TR]
[TD]SUD[/TD]
[TD="align: right"]21-gen-13[/TD]
[TD]Giorgia[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]7-giu-14[/TD]
[TD]Giulia[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]14-lug-12[/TD]
[TD]Anna[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]12-apr-19[/TD]
[TD]Giulia[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]13-feb-22[/TD]
[TD]Luis[/TD]
[/TR]
[TR]
[TD]EST[/TD]
[TD="align: right"]11-mar-20[/TD]
[TD]Andrea[/TD]
[/TR]
[/TABLE]
 
  • #10
GerryZ said:
Not workin
is possible to add a botton to add the grid?

Yes, a button could be added somewhere that would execute javascript to use regex to make the replacement to add the grid class, or it could be automatically added on preview/submit (but then no one would be able to post tables without grids). :)
 
  • #11
MarkFL said:
or it could be automatically added on preview/submit (but then no one would be able to post tables without grids). :)
Beautiful, Your words are so professional...
I think the best way do to, is your second suggestion and doesn't mutter if no one is no longer able to post table without grids, my forum talk about excel my users will understand the grid
I don't know how you are going to fix the border, but important is tha any user can copy and paste a table with borders from excel to the formu
One more thing I prefere to keep WYSIWYG mode becouse is connected with another MOD( [vBFoster Lite] With Attachments in Quick reply and Advanced Editor ) that i need to keep it because is very important for my users

Thank You fo now and see you later
 
Last edited:
  • #12
Hello I'm back again
I wonder if I need to make a modificantion into the vB bullettin template or istall a MOD plugins?
Yhank you for your answer but for me is very important
Ciao
 

Similar threads

  • · Replies 2 ·
Replies
2
Views
3K
  • · Replies 10 ·
Replies
10
Views
4K
  • · Replies 4 ·
Replies
4
Views
2K
  • · Replies 23 ·
Replies
23
Views
6K